About the role: As a Principal Project Controls Specialist with Long Term Operations (LTO) Engineered Solutions team, you will lead project schedule and management activities for large, high complexity, projects. You will be responsible for leading cost control and management activities on complex projects and across product areas, which will include Identifying, and implementing value-add opportunities which will improve overall cost/schedule performance. You will apply tools and techniques to plan work such that inefficiencies are reduced, and overall project performance is optimized while also reviewing portfolio costs and providing reports to the project management team to ensure cost performance is to plan. You may also lead small diverse discipline teams through project phases and may be assigned to several complex projects simultaneously. You will spend ~60% of time supporting scheduling updates in Primavera P6, and ~40% supporting cost evaluation, adjusting billing milestones, updating SAP as requested. You will report to the Manager of LTO ES Project Controls. This is a remote role that can be performed from anywhere within the United States. Key Responsibilities:
